dateDiff - Amazon QuickSight

dateDiff

dateDiff retorna a diferença de dias entre dois campos de data. Se você incluir um valor para o período, dateDiff retorna a diferença no intervalo do período, em vez de em dias.

Sintaxe

dateDiff(date1, date2,[period])

Argumentos

dateDiff leva duas datas como argumentos. Especificar um período é opcional.

data 1

A primeira data na comparação. Um campo de data ou uma chamada para outra função que gera uma data.

data 2

A segunda data na comparação. Um campo de data ou uma chamada para outra função que gera uma data.

período

O período de diferença que você quer que retorne, entre aspas. Os períodos válidos são:

  • AAAA: retorna a parte do ano da data.

  • P: Isso retorna a data do primeiro dia do trimestre ao qual a data pertence.

  • MM: Isto retorna a parte do mês da data.

  • DD: retorna a parte do dia da data.

  • WK: retorna a parte da semana da data. A semana começa no domingo no Amazon QuickSight.

  • HH: retorna a parte da hora da data.

  • MI: Isto retorna a parte do minuto da data.

  • SS: Isto retorna a parte do segundo da data.

  • MS: isso retorna a parte do milissegundo da data.

Tipo de retorno

Inteiro

Exemplo

O exemplo a seguir retorna a diferença entre duas datas.

dateDiff(orderDate, shipDate, "MM")

A seguir estão os valores de campo especificados.

orderDate shipdate ============================= 01/01/18 03/05/18 09/13/17 10/20/17

Para esses valores de campo, os seguintes valores são retornados.

2 1